General Motors recently unveiled the Cadillac Vistiq, the latest addition to its growing portfolio of battery-electric vehicles. According to the automaker, the Vistiq is a three-row electric SUV designed to slot into the Cadillac lineup, offering an estimated driving range of up to 300 miles on a full charge. The model is expected to rival other luxury electric SUVs, including the Tesla Model X, Rivian R1S, and upcoming offerings from BMW and Mercedes-Benz. The Vistiq’s name aligns with Cadillac’s EV naming convention, joining the Lyriq and the hand-built Celestiq flagship. While GM has not yet released detailed pricing or a specific launch date, the vehicle is expected to be positioned in the premium segment, potentially with a starting price north of $70,000—similar to other luxury electric SUVs. The Vistiq is part of GM’s accelerated electrification strategy, which aims to offer 30 all-electric models globally by 2025 and achieve carbon neutrality by 2040. The company has previously committed to spending $35 billion through 2025 on EV and autonomous vehicle development. The introduction of the Cadillac Vistiq comes at a time when the luxury EV space is becoming increasingly crowded. Competitors such as Rivian, Lucid, and legacy automakers are all vying for consumer attention. The 300-mile range positions the Vistiq competitively, as many mainstream premium EVs target between 280 and 320 miles. However, GM faces challenges including supply chain constraints, battery production scale-up, and consumer adoption hesitancy amid high interest rates. For GM, the Vistiq represents an effort to bolster the Cadillac brand’s EV credentials and attract high-income buyers. Cadillac has already seen moderate success with the Lyriq, which launched in 2023. Expanding the lineup could help GM gain economies of scale in its Ultium battery platform, which underpins the Vistiq and other GM EVs. Analysts note that GM must also navigate federal tax credit eligibility requirements, as some of its models have faced phased-out benefits due to battery sourcing rules. From an investment perspective, the success of the Vistiq could influence GM’s market positioning in the EV transition. If GM manages to deliver the vehicle on time and at a competitive price point, it may help the company capture a larger share of the premium EV market, which is projected to grow double-digits annually. However, execution risks remain—including production ramp-up, software reliability, and consumer perception of legacy automakers in the EV space. Investors will likely monitor GM’s upcoming earnings calls for updates on Vistiq production timelines and pre-order numbers. The broader market context includes ongoing price wars in the EV sector led by Tesla, which could pressure margins. GM’s strategy of offering a full range of EVs from mass-market Chevrolet to luxury Cadillac could provide diversification benefits, but the company must prove it can achieve profitability in its EV segment.
